Red (Japanese: レッド) is the first main character of the manga series Pokémon Special. His first Pokémon was a Poliwag, which evolved into a Poliwhirl when saving him from drowning.

Red is eleven years old at the beginning of Generation I. He is first seen in Glimpse of the Glow, when he shows a group of children the proper way to catch a Pokémon. He demonstrates by using his Poliwhirl to battle a wild Nidorino. Red is very sentimental, as shown in the battle versus Green in the ninth annual Pokémon League tournament. He believes that defeating an opponent is no fun if they are at a disadvantage, as seen in both The Secret of Kangaskhan and Make Way for Magmar!. At the beginning of the series, he is quite cocky, as shown in Suddenly Starmie. However, this cockiness has subsided by the end of the RGB Saga.

Red's special skill, as described by Oak, is Pokémon battling. He is called the "battler" (戦う者).

Red, Green & Blue chapter

In this saga, Red is the main protagonist. His main rival is Green. Red set off across Kanto to collect the Gym Badges to enter the Pokémon League tournament. Along the way, he learns of Team Rocket by befriending Misty in Gyarados Splashes In! and training with her in Suddenly Starmie.

Later, Red has his Badges stolen by a mischievous trainer called Blue. Eventually, Red, Green, and Blue team up to defeat Team Rocket's admins - Lt. Surge, Koga, and Sabrina who were using the Legendary Birds to take over Saffron City. Red also meets Blaine, and helps him capture the escaped experimental Pokémon Mewtwo, so that Blaine can cure them of the empathic connection they share.

Red later encounters Yellow in Viridian Forest and finds that Team Rocket has been releasing abused Pokémon into the Forest to make them stronger. Red meets Giovanni and defeats him in an intense battle.

With the badges he gained, Red is able to enter the Pokémon League and emerge as a Champion of the 9th Pokémon League competition. This makes him interesting to the Elite Four.

Yellow chapter

Red was challenged by the Elite Four, who wanted him to join them in their quest to wipe out humanity. When he refused, Lorelei froze him in a block of ice. Only Pika escapes and makes it to Yellow. Giovanni rescues him and he seeks out his friends who are fighting the Elite 4.

Gold, Silver & Crystal chapter

Red is offered the newly open position of Viridian City Gym Leader, but has to turn it down due to injuries from being frozen. He leaves to recuperate at the springs in Mt. Silver. Later, he and the other main characters team up with several Legendary Pokémon to help fight the Mask of Ice. At the end of the story, Gold becomes impressed with Red and goes to train under him at Mt. Silver.

FireRed & LeafGreen chapter

Red, Green, and Blue return to visit Professor Oak, who was kidnapped to make PokéDexs for Team Rocket and taken to the Sevii Islands. There at the islands, Red, Blue and Green fight the new Team Rocket Admins, the Beast Warrior Trio, as well as Deoxys, who is under control of Giovanni. Red undergoes special training on the second Sevii Island where his Venusaur learns Frenzy Plant. However, he is still defeated by Deoxys, who he shares a strange connection with.

Mewtwo shows up and offers to battle under Red's command to get revenge on Deoxys. Mewtwo manages to defeat Deoxys on the Team Rocket helicopter. However, one of the Beast Warrior Trio has placed his Forretress' all over the helicopter and ordered them to use Explosion, and while Deoxys transports everyone else aboard to safety, Red stays behind to defeat the Forretress' and stop the aircraft from blowing up over Vermillion.

Deoxys absorbed Red's blood when it broke free from Team Rocket's lab.

At the end of the saga, Red is turned to stone.

Pokémon

Red's Pokémon nicknames are taken from two syllables from their Japanese language-version names.

On hand

Nyoro is Red's first Pokémon, and has been with him since early childhood. Nyoro is very loyal and evolved to save Red from drowning. He excels at physical attacks, as well as Ice Beam. It debuted as Poliwhirl in A Glimpse of the Glow. Captured as Poliwhirl before A Glimpse of the Glow.

Pika was once a mischievous Pokémon that terrorized Pewter City stealing food, causing trouble, and shocking people. Pika befriended Yellow, and mated with Yellow's Pikachu, Chuchu to produce Gold's Pichu. When Pika was accidentally traded to Green, it was taught a variety of different moves, such as Substitute and Toxic. Under Yellow's care, it later learned how to Surf. Debuted and captured in Wanted: Pikachu!.

Gyara once belonged to Misty, but it was captured and experimented on by Team Rocket to make it more fierce. Red recaught it when it was out of control and gived it back to Misty. Later, when Red was unable to get the Surf HM, Misty traded Gyara for Red's Krabby so that Red could reach Cinnabar Island. Debuted in Gyarados Splashes In!.

Red caught Gon because he was blocking the road during a bicycle race. Gon is very gluttonous and is driven into a frenzy by the smell of honey. Later, after extensive training, Gon becomes one of the most physically powerful members of Red's team.

Red acquired Pte when Blaine resurrected him from a piece of Old Amber on Cinnabar Island to help Blaine fight off a Moltres that Team Rocket had captured. Red uses Pte whenever he needs to get somewhere by flying.

In box

Vui was a Pokémon experimented on by Team Rocket that Red captured under Erika's direction. It was genetically modified to have unstable DNA, allowing it to evolve and devolve from Eevee, to Jolteon, Flareon, and Vaporeon when exposed to new stones. Later, Red was able to heal its emotional trauma and it permanently evolved into Espeon. Red adds Vui to his team whenever Pika is with Yellow or needs a rest.

Formerly owned

Fushii was the Pokémon Red received from Professor Oak. It is one of his most powerful team members and has defeated Green's Charizard in battle. Professor Oak gave it to him because Red figured out how to let it use its powerful Solarbeam attack to a Machoke they encountered in the Viridian City Gym. In the Sevii Islands, Fushii learned Frenzy Plant, an extremely powerful attack only Venusaur can learn. Debuted and captured as Bulbasaur in Bulbasaur, Come Home!.
